Essential Camera and Lighting Terminology

To simulate a realistic photo style, your prompt must explicitly define the optical characteristics of the shot. Generic terms like "nice picture" are insufficient for high-quality output. Instead, incorporate specific photography jargon that dictates depth of field, focal length, and light quality. For a holiday greeting, you might want a soft, inviting atmosphere that mimics natural winter sunlight or cozy indoor lighting.

Start by specifying the camera type or lens. Terms such as "shot on 85mm lens," "f/1.8 aperture," or "shallow depth of field" help the model understand that you want the subject to stand out against a blurred background. This technique is crucial for holiday portraits where the focus should remain on the person or the central festive object. Additionally, describe the lighting conditions clearly. Use phrases like "soft golden hour sunlight," "warm candlelight glow," or "diffused overcast window light." These descriptors prevent the image from looking flat or artificially lit, which is a common pitfall when working with faster, cost-optimized models.

Step-by-Step Prompt Construction Guide

Follow these numbered steps to construct a robust prompt for your holiday greeting within the Nano Banana interface:

  1. Define the Subject and Setting: Clearly state who or what is in the image. For example, "A smiling family gathered around a Christmas tree in a living room."
  2. Add Photographic Constraints: Immediately follow the subject with camera details. Add "photographed with a 50mm prime lens, f/2.8 aperture, shallow depth of field."
  3. Specify Lighting and Atmosphere: Describe the mood through light. Include "warm ambient lighting, soft shadows, dust motes dancing in the light, 4k resolution."
  4. Refine for Model Limitations: Acknowledge the Lite model's focus on speed. Keep the prompt concise but descriptive. Avoid overly complex multi-turn editing requests, as Nano Banana 2 Lite is not optimized for sequential editing workflows.
  5. Review and Generate: Check the prompt for clarity before hitting generate. Remember that this is an example workflow; actual results will vary based on the stochastic nature of the model.

Evaluating Results and Troubleshooting Common Issues

After generating your holiday greeting, you must evaluate the output critically. Because Nano Banana 2 Lite is focused on speed and cost, it may produce images that lack the fine-grained detail found in higher-tier models. Look for artifacts in the hands, facial features, or background textures. If the image looks too smooth or plastic-like, try adjusting your lighting keywords to include more texture descriptors like "grainy film look" or "high dynamic range."

If the model struggles with the realism of the scene, consider simplifying the prompt. Complex scenes with many interacting elements often confuse faster models. Try isolating the main subject and reducing the number of background objects.
